This workshop aims to prepare participants with the skills required in order to establish excellent customer service within their role. The workshop will cover: ways of creating a positive and welcoming first impression, telephone or online calls best practice, being aware of making assumptions, understanding prerequisites of good customer service, understanding body language of our customers and our own.

The workshop will also look at effective forms of communication, active listening, building empathy and rapport and finally looking at steps to diffuse a customer’s anger.
